There's nothing Klay Thompson loves more than basketball. But the Golden State Warriors star definitely has his dog Rocco as a close second.

An amazing piece from The Athletic's Jayson Jenks, Rustin Dodd, and more revealed just how much the Warriors sharpshooter loves his dog Rocco, with first-hand accounts from teammates past and present to prove it. Festus Ezeli, who was drafted by the Warriors back in 2012, revealed Thompson's affinity for his canine has been since Day 1.

“When I got drafted and started hanging out with Klay was when he first got Rocco,” said the ex-Warriors big man. “He would always want to spend time with the dog. He didn’t even really like hanging out with people. I’d be like, ‘What are you doing?' He’d be like, ‘Hanging out with Rocco.' I thought it was (a person) at first before I met the dog. I was like, ‘For real?'”

Klay Thompson's former teammate James McAdoo and Kevon Looney shared how Rocco was even there for the Warriors' playoff run. He very well could be the All-Star's good luck charm, given how deadly Klay gets when he's locked in during the postseason.

Looney: We were in the playoffs. I think we were about to go to the conference finals. Rocco just walked into the locker room. He went into the shower while everybody was showering, just walking around.

McAdoo: It was nothing for Rocco to show up at the Warriors practice facility.

Looney: I’m like, “We just let dogs just come into the locker room, walking around, chilling, wandering into the showers during the playoffs?” I remember (Anderson) Varejao telling me, “Hey, nowhere else in the NBA could this happen. Only Klay.”

Klay Thompson has had a grueling journey recovering from his injuries from the past two seasons. But fortunately the Warriors star had Rocco by his side the entire time.
